Motorway closed for five hours after 24 vehicle pile up

Posted on - 3rd April, 2019 - 8:34am | Author - | Posted in - Broughton, Cottam, Fulwood, Preston News, Preston weather, Roads, Transport, Uncategorized, Woodplumpton

The M55 was closed for five hours last night after 24 vehicles collided in the carriageway.

A sudden snowstorm led to treacherous driving conditions with several motorists losing control of their vehicles.

Gritters set out across the county to make the roads safer, and diversions were put in place between junctions 1 and 3 of the M55.

Lancashire Road Police Tweeted: “Thankfully no serious injuries but it was carnage.”

The motorway was reopened at around 3am.
